• 1258688
    Price range:
    +
    €0.6094
    74+
    €0.5655
    152+
    €0.5447
    319+
    €0.5188
    1000+
    €0.4929
    Not available
    Notify instock
Viewed products
17.4000
0.7101
0.8700
0.8700
ETI
0.8700
0.2546
4.3500
0.8700
ETI
0.8700
TTS300/D230/35-35V
0.8700